lib/solvers/glpk.rb in rulp-0.0.43 vs lib/solvers/glpk.rb in rulp-0.0.44

- old
+ new

@@ -1,8 +1,11 @@ class Glpk < Solver def solve command = "#{executable} --lp #{@filename} %s --cuts --output #{@outfile}" - command %= options[:gap] ? "--mipgap #{options[:gap]}" : "" + command %= [ + options[:gap] ? "--mipgap #{options[:gap]}" : "", + options[:time_limit] ? "--tmlim #{options[:time_limit]}" : "" + ] exec(command) end def self.executable :glpsol \ No newline at end of file